httpx-auth

View on PyPIReverse Dependencies (10)

0.21.0 httpx_auth-0.21.0-py3-none-any.whl

Wheel Details

Project: httpx-auth
Version: 0.21.0
Filename: httpx_auth-0.21.0-py3-none-any.whl
Download: [link]
Size: 45067
MD5: c651520856be82828439b1f4785b4b4a
SHA256: 281e2566b92d1bdce7346a6662cca14082ad8a6d7b2601c5947c5b5f21e6d5bc
Uploaded: 2024-02-18 23:38:19 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: httpx_auth
Version: 0.21.0
Summary: Authentication for HTTPX
Author-Email: Colin Bounouar <colin.bounouar.dev[at]gmail.com>
Maintainer-Email: Colin Bounouar <colin.bounouar.dev[at]gmail.com>
Project-Url: documentation, https://colin-b.github.io/httpx_auth/
Project-Url: repository, https://github.com/Colin-b/httpx_auth
Project-Url: changelog, https://github.com/Colin-b/httpx_auth/blob/master/CHANGELOG.md
Project-Url: issues, https://github.com/Colin-b/httpx_auth/issues
License: MIT License Copyright (c) 2024 Colin Bounouar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ions: The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software. TH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
Keywords: authentication,oauth2,aws,okta,aad,entra
Classifier: Development Status :: 5 - Production/Stable
Classifier: Intended Audience :: Developers
Classifier: License :: OSI Approved :: MIT License
Classifier: Natural Language :: English
Classifier: Typing :: Typed
Classifier: Programming Language :: Python
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.9
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Topic :: Software Development :: Build Tools
Requires-Python: >=3.9
Requires-Dist: httpx (==0.26.*)
Requires-Dist: pyjwt (==2.*); extra == "testing"
Requires-Dist: pytest-httpx (==0.29.*); extra == "testing"
Requires-Dist: time-machine (==2.*); extra == "testing"
Requires-Dist: pytest-cov (==4.*); extra == "testing"
Requires-Dist: pytest-asyncio (==0.23.*); extra == "testing"
Provides-Extra: testing
Description-Content-Type: text/markdown
License-File: LICENSE
[Description omitted; length: 73109 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.42.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
httpx_auth/__init__.py sha256=oz5UHOIXPSsTdiU6dHAPp0db578cuH96EVjDDvKc850 2112
httpx_auth/_authentication.py sha256=f0rki7lOS9kl-ahxZiQ1jZ4xniLW6y68hAaboCVZ0RY 3172
httpx_auth/_aws.py sha256=hzHIkjODFhrFYDvKhTw-VINDofn3qWmyiJLNkOmiLAE 15752
httpx_auth/_errors.py sha256=p-FBjYv9Zj2qH869rZOoHVtLPtQUqhTaPEiSyc7d-IQ 6406
httpx_auth/py.typed s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
httpx_auth/testing.py sha256=OD3d2vaUtWkZ2Ljh0PEHD_t63tK3t5BVCKwv_ticRUw 8787
httpx_auth/version.py sha256=K8vforEvqPLq0ezkeKVVsN5NVtkni9O2ztfQ3R8aLiE 372
httpx_auth/_oauth2/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
httpx_auth/_oauth2/authentication_responses_server.py sha256=E2H_9Ye79S3oKgfa1pOnzHhA4f8skCoamPNV92R2-io 8195
httpx_auth/_oauth2/authorization_code.py sha256=Gf_XHsxJcsj8fN_r-PdYF6gmysaasKqdcWKwD784tZw 14958
httpx_auth/_oauth2/authorization_code_pkce.py sha256=HuiC15S6klHu9qrI7sHZjQrjq3iwq98RsGB0fcYjMyA 13590
httpx_auth/_oauth2/browser.py sha256=t2eV79gqsvphNix27UURRCHiJowpMiVnaXPHLR5pg-U 4869
httpx_auth/_oauth2/client_credentials.py sha256=x9_ltza5F4hxRSnUbxmqNCbTMd3Qv6LEvpL8Zi_zC1c 7389
httpx_auth/_oauth2/common.py sha256=PaZlkrOeng0y5dZTvHZqYL2hOmc9Ydzp4G4TdKA_L3A 2991
httpx_auth/_oauth2/implicit.py sha256=EHCIKBh6fbwI8DCHTdlIgmpVBTRGGTGGMoakNTKoOhU 17635
httpx_auth/_oauth2/resource_owner_password.py sha256=t1fk-H5hI2r0XGZEpDC7wBI359MKcGJzOe5-5PO5oQU 9213
httpx_auth/_oauth2/tokens.py sha256=F6R92e2PcBVz-a3S0E_NF5KbFcHZPI1hO_snBF93d7Q 9763
httpx_auth-0.21.0.dist-info/LICENSE sha256=hlOb5wFFIjZczsih5GOMSUY0k4HLdhNPOozJsj0JExE 1071
httpx_auth-0.21.0.dist-info/METADATA sha256=nvJebCAfc44LGSDX7HOtALRM0EtzbNN22yz4PVZX8FU 75888
httpx_auth-0.21.0.dist-info/WHEEL sha256=oiQVh_5PnQM0E3gPdiz09WCNmwiHDMaGer_elqB3coM 92
httpx_auth-0.21.0.dist-info/top_level.txt sha256=VkrgEEa2gF1BIMLU_HpkQfBeiOO7zvziQJzuBE-uUj8 11
httpx_auth-0.21.0.dist-info/RECORD

top_level.txt

httpx_auth